Buckeye Elementary School District Job Description

Summer School Teacher (Internal)

Dates: June 1 - June 19, 7:30am-12:30pm

Pay Rate: $35.00 per hour

REPORTS TO: Site Principal

JOB DESCRIPTION: Plans and implements an instructional program and provides related educational services for summer school students. Manages student behavior, assesses and evaluates student achievement, and modifies instructional activities as required; carries out a variety of student monitoring activities; performs related duties as required or assigned.

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college/university
  • Valid Arizona teaching certificate with Early Childhood Endorsement
  • One year of successful teaching experience
  • IVP Fingerprint Clearance Card
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Assesses student abilities as related to desired district educational goals, objectives, and outcomes.
  • Plans appropriate instructional/learning strategies and activities, including determination of appropriate principles of learning, classroom organizational structures, and kind and level of materials.
  • Implements an instructional program which provides appropriate learning experiences for each student.
  • Manages the behavior of learners in an instructional setting to ensure the environment is conducive to the learning experiences for each student.
  • Utilizes a variety of instructional materials and available multimedia and computer technology to enhance learning.
  • Requests assistance of and works with resource personnel as needed. Works in a self-contained, team, departmental, itinerant capacity, or at field work site, as assigned.
  • Continually assesses student achievement and maintains appropriate assessment and evaluation documentation for institutional and individual reporting purposes.
  • Ensures ongoing communication with parents, both written and oral, to keep them informed of student progress.
  • Provides age-appropriate communication with students on instructional expectations and keeps them informed of their progress in meeting those expectations.
  • Manages allotted learning time to maximize student achievement.
  • Assigns work to and supervises instructional assistants and parent and student volunteers if applicable.
  • Ensures the classroom and/or instructional environment is welcoming, healthful, safe and conducive to learning and that materials are in good condition and accessible to students.
  • Monitors student behavior in non-instructional areas as assigned or required and intervenes to control and modify disruptive behavior, reporting to administrator as appropriate.
